Bread and Bakery Products - Statistics & Facts

The on-going year (2018 ) is witnessing fresh market dynamics which have propelled bakeries worldwide to take note of new consumer touch points, tastes & preferences, and contemporary delivery systems. In the US, where the bakery industry is thriving, the following statistics emerge:-

  • Current consumption of Bread and Bakery products are pegged at approximately $ 69 million.
  • The average per capita consumption is 42.5 kg / year.
  • The per person consumption is $ 207 /year.
  • The average price per unit is expected to be $ 4.88 in 2018.
  • The US bakery products includes more than 2,800 commercial bakeries with combined annual revenue of about $ 30 billion, along with 6,700 retail bakeries with annual revenue of about $3 billion.
  • In the US, the commercial side of the industry is concentrated ie, the 50 largest companies generate 75% of the revenue. The retail side again, is highly fragmented ie, the 50 largest companies generate 20% of the revenue.

( Source : American Bakery Association )

Changing Market Dynamics ( Pertaining to the US )

  • With the decreasing cost of primary ingredients, the prices of most bakery items expected to diminish, making the cakes, cookies, tarts, pies cheaper for the consumers.
  • On the part of manufacturers as well, this decrease in the cost of production will enhance their profitability, since they can adjust their cost-revenue parameters better.
  • Many bakeries may trim down their product lines and focus on consumer preferences and seasonal varieties. Finding a balance between offering a variety to more consumers and offering truly profitable products will call for a detail analysis of the cost-revenue parameters.
  • Growth of demand is determined by several factors germane to consumer preferences, which can range from more chocolaty, more sweety, more darker brownies to gluten-free and salty treats.
  • Increase in disposable income of consumers, fresh innovations in cakes, cookies, pies by the retailers, or even the influx of tourists at certain times, all add up towards this growth in demand.
  • Retail bakeries in smaller towns will be driven more by branding and tie-ups. Teaming up with local theaters, sports and musical events will drive demand. The bakeries can offer more specialty items with more efficient logistics support.
  • In larger cities, profitability will be determined by the efficiency of operations. Larger companies , due to their larger scales, have the advantage in procurement, production and distribution.
  • Retail companies, who manufacture their own bakery items such as cakes, muffins and croissants will be able to sell more to the supermarkets, convenience stores and food-service bars and restaurants in their locality.
  • As the economy recovers and disposable income increases, revenue is expected to grow at an average annual rate of 0.6% within the next five years to $ 39.9 billion. Consumer preferences are expected to be skewed in favor of healthier, gluten-free breads, sprouts and organic sweets. (Source : IBISWorld )
